The format of the book adheres to the respected "in Use" methodology: a page of clear explanation followed by a page of exercises. This left-page/right-page structure transforms the learning process from passive reading into active engagement. The explanations are demystifying; they strip away the confusion. For instance, a student might be baffled why English speakers "make" a decision but "do" homework. The text breaks down these collocations and fixed phrases, which are essentially the building blocks of idiomatic fluency. When accessed as a PDF, this format allows students to interact with the material on their tablets or laptops, making "dead time"—like a commute or a waiting room—productive study sessions.
